#482c82 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#482c82 is composed of 28.2% red, 17.3%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.6% cyan, 66.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 259.5 degrees, a saturation of 49.4% and a lightness of 34.1%. #482c82 color hex could be obtained by blending #9058ff with #000005.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

● #482c82 color description : Dark moderate violet.
#482c82 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#482c82 has RGB values of R:72, G:44,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0.66,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 4729986.
